We have modelled the Brazilian tailings dam failure using a Non-Newtonian large domain hydraulics solver. Not just a material slump, not like water. It is important to model it correctly! Risk planning saves lives. #Brumadinho

Terrible images and reports coming out of Brazil today about the tailings dam failure at a large mine. We've been working on non-newtonian dynamics to model failure of tailings dams. Understanding failures like this means better mapping, emergency planning, and risk management
